James Allan Kearse is a registered financial advisor currently at MUTUAL OF OMAHA INVESTOR SERVICES, INC. located in Denver, Colorado.
James is registered as an IAR (Investment Advisor Representative) and RR (Registered Representative) and started their career in finance in 2012. James has worked at 2 firms and has passed the Series 63, Series 65, SIE and Series 6 exams.
